Hardship Payments

Are you struggling to pay your Council Tax and in receipt of Council Tax Support? 

You may be able to apply for a Council Tax Support Hardship payments.

Hardship Payments are a top-up to Council Tax Support and are available if we consider that someone needs extra help with their Council Tax costs.  They are not payments of Council Tax Support but are discretionary and funded by the council.

If you are experiencing exceptional financial hardship, then you may be able to claim some assistance with your Council Tax. However Hardship Payments are only available as short-term assistance, not a long-term solution.

We have a limited budget to spend on these payments, so require an application form to help us decide if a payment can be made to you.

This is not a cash payment, but a credit to your Council Tax account.

What can Hardship Payments cover?

  • A shortfall between amount of Council Tax Support awarded and your Council Tax liability

What Hardship Payments cannot cover?

  • to reduce any Council Tax Support recoverable overpayment
  • where an authorised officer from North Warwickshire Borough Council considers there are unnecessary expenses
  • if the means tested assessment shows that there is no financial hardship
  • to cover a shortfall caused by a Department for Work and Pensions sanction or suspension which has been applied because the Council Taxpayer has turned down work, interview or training opportunities
  • Shortfalls for Council Tax liabilities outside of North Warwickshire Borough Council

Who Can apply for Hardship Payment?

To be eligible for a Hardship Payment you must be in receipt of Council Tax Support with North Warwickshire Bourgh Council and satisfy us that you require further help with your Council Tax costs by providing details of your income and expenditure and proofs as necessary.

You cannot apply if you do not receive Council Tax Support with North Warwickshire Bourgh Council.

How can I apply for Hardship Payment?

We may ask you to provide evidence to verify your situation which could include asking for evidence of your income and expenses. Your claim will not be processed until the evidence requested is provided in full.

Funds for Hardship Payments are limited, so not all applications will be successful.

If the application is from someone acting on your behalf, please make this clear on the form.
